--- title: experimental.mean() function description: > The `experimental.mean()` function computes the mean or average of non-null values in the `_value` column of each input table. menu: flux_0_x_ref: name: experimental.mean parent: experimental weight: 302 aliases: - /influxdb/v2.0/reference/flux/experimental/mean - /influxdb/cloud/reference/flux/experimental/mean related: - /flux/v0.x/stdlib/universe/mean - /{{< latest "influxdb" "v1" >}}/query_language/functions/#mean, InfluxQL – MEAN() flux/v0.x/tags: [transformations, aggregates] introduced: 0.107.0 --- The `experimental.mean()` function computes the mean or average of non-null values in the `_value` column of each input table. Output tables contain a single row the with the calculated mean in the `_value` column. _`experimental.mean()` is an [aggregate function](/flux/v0.x/function-types/#aggregates)._ ```js import "experimental" experimental.mean() ``` ## Parameters ### tables {data-type="stream of tables"} Input data. Default is piped-forward data (`<-`). ## Examples ```js import "experimental" from(bucket: "example-bucket") |> filter(fn: (r) => r._measurement == "example-measurement" and r._field == "example-field") |> range(start: -1h) |> experimental.mean() ```
